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chinese Pangolin | squirrel’s tail hydroid |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Cnidaria (Cnidarians)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Hydrozoa (Hydrozoa) |
| Order | Pholidota (Pholidota) | Leptothecata (Leptothecata) |
| Family | Manidae | Sertulariidae |
| Genus | Manis | Sertularia |
| Species | Manis pentadactyla | Sertularia argentea |
Evolutionary Relationship
Chinese Pangolin and squirrel’s tail hydroid share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
